Kirsten Childs' BELLA: AN AMERICAN TALL TALE Gets Cast Recording
by Stephi Wild - Feb 6, 2019

Playwrights Horizons (Artistic Director Tim Sanford, Managing Director Leslie Marcus) and Yellow Sound Label announce the release of the original cast recording of Kristen Childs' rowdy, wild, and hilarious Bella: An American Tall Tale. Hard copies of the album, produced by Michael Croiter, can be purchased at yellowsoundlabel.com and phnyc.org beginning February 22, when it will also become available digitally on iTunes, Amazon, Spotify, and Apple Music. BWW Review: BELLA: AN AMERICAN TALL TALE at Dallas Theater Center
by Kyle Christopher West - Oct 6, 2016

There are few things in the world as thrilling as seeing a new work come to life on stage, especially when that stage is the Dallas Theater Center's Wyly Theatre, our local answer to Broadway-caliber theatre. The anticipation and possibility of being the first one to discover a new hit is so exciting - but it is balanced by the opportunity for a show to be unexceptional or 'not ready for primetime.' BELLA: AN AMERICAN TALL TALE, in this writer's opinion, falls into the latter category.
Kelli O'Hara, Rebecca Luker, Jason Robert Brown & More to Perform at 2014 Lilly Awards, 6/2
by Tyler Peterson - May 29, 2014

This year the Lilly Awards will celebrate women of distinction in musical theater in a special cabaret at West Bank Cafe (407 W 42nd Street, NYC), following the awards ceremony, which is set for Monday, June 2, at Playwrights Horizons. The cabaret will feature Kelli O'Hara, Rebecca Naomi Jones, Rebecca Luker, Kate Baldwin, Kenita Miller, The Broadway Boys, Graham Rowat, Katie Thompson, Lauren Pritchard, Taylor Noble, Jay Armstrong Jonson, The Skivvies (Lauren Molina & Nick Cearley) and Jason Robert Brown.
